Output 68ba3e936421d6cdc08c782da63b7e8ce65d84f112505f50938f3eab97b599c5:8

value
49444697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7635017d7a043c0aaf632c0cfea42cc4d2ff536 OP_EQUAL
address
MQcpruxdEj1rUYb7G5LW6Gez3H51W5RmrQ
transaction
68ba3e936421d6cdc08c782da63b7e8ce65d84f112505f50938f3eab97b599c5
spent
true